QOSMOSYS

Qosmosys develops advanced spacecraft and lunar infrastructure services for public and private space exploration. The company specializes in creating ZeusX, a versatile spacecraft designed to transport payloads and materials to various orbits and lunar surfaces. Their services cover transportation, robotics, resources, and scientific technologies, with a focus on making lunar operations more accessible and economically viable. Qosmosys provides comprehensive solutions for organizations looking to operate beyond Earth, including data transmission, resource production, and mission support for lunar environments.
JAXA (The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ency)

JAXA is a space exploration organization that develops, launches, and operates advanced aerospace technologies. The agency conducts scientific research through satellite missions, planetary exploration, and space station operations. JAXA explores the universe by launching telecommunications satellites, Earth observation systems, space telescopes, and robotic probes. The organization collaborates internationally, develops spacecraft, trains astronauts, and conducts cutting-edge experiments in space environments.
ESA (European Space Agency)

European Space Agency (ESA) develops advanced space technologies and conducts scientific exploration beyond Earth. The organization launches missions to explore planets, operates satellites for Earth observation, and collaborates with international space agencies to advance human understanding of space. ESA designs spacecraft, conducts scientific research, and provides critical navigation and telecommunication services through innovative space technologies.
Astrobotic

Astrobotic develops advanced space robotics and lunar landing technologies. The company delivers payloads to the Moon for governments, universities, and private organizations using specialized spacecraft. With over 60 NASA and commercial contracts worth $600 million, Astrobotic creates lunar landers, rovers, and navigation systems designed to make lunar exploration more accessible and cost-effective.
